Breast Cancer
New breast cancer research from C.C. Orgeas et al outlined
February 26th, 2009
According to recent research from Stockholm, Sweden, "To assess the impact of infertility treatment with causes of infertility on incidence of breast cancer. Historical prospective cohort study of 1135 women attending major university clinics for treatment of infertility in Sweden, 1961-1976." "Women were classified as users of clomiphene citrate or gonadotropins, or a combination of both therapies. Standardized incidence ratios were calculated to estimate relative risk of breast cancer. We observed 54 cases of breast cancer during 1961-2004, which did not significantly exceed those expected. Users of high-dose clomiphene citrate had an almost 2-fold increased risk...
